Belonging for the English Royal Navy, the HMS Temeraire was a next-price warship with 98 guns. Despite the ship’s wonderful past, it is depicted within the paintings as it truly is staying pulled together by a tugboat on its strategy to being taken apart for scrap. This landscape painting was manufactured in tribute to the final days with the magnificent sailing vessels from the day because they designed place for the new and enhanced steam-driven models that were taking up.
